Enterprise Architecture

Enterprise Architecture (EA) serves as a strategic framework that guides the planning, development, and management of IT capabilities to align with and support both current and future business goals. Far beyond just technology, EA encompasses the entire organizational structure, identifying all key components that enable the organization to operate effectively.
